Domi (lower-body) has been placed on IR retroactive to November 16th.

Domi will not play on Wednesday due to a lower-body injury but will be eligible to be activated from Injured Reserve before the Maple Leafs' following game on Novemeber 24th against the Utah Hockey Club. The 29-year-old Domi has struggled with the Maple Leaf this season, going without a point in 13 straight games. The Maple Leafs have recalled Nikita Grebyonkin from the Toronto Marlies (AHL).

Joshua (testicular cancer) is expected to make his season debut vs. the Islanders on Thursday.

In mid-September, the Canucks announced that 28-year-old Dakota Joshua had been diagnosed with testicular cancer and successfully had a tumor removed but would not be ready for the start of training camp. After several months of recovery, Joshua is expected to make his season debut, likely with limited minutes on the fourth line. The fifth-year winger is coming off his best season in 2023-24, with 18 goals, 32 points, 60 PIMs, 84 SOG, and a +19 plus/minus through 63 games played.
